• Keine Ergebnisse gefunden

Abgabe: 11. Dezember 2019 zu Beginn der ¨ Ubung

N/A
N/A
Protected

Academic year: 2022

Aktie "Abgabe: 11. Dezember 2019 zu Beginn der ¨ Ubung"

Copied!
1
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

7. ¨ Ubung zur Vorlesung

“Einf¨ uhrung in die Bioinformatik I, 1. Teil”

Wintersemester 2019/2020

Prof. Peter Dittrich, Emanuel Barth, Marcus Ludwig Ausgabe: 4. Dezember 2019,

Abgabe: 11. Dezember 2019 zu Beginn der ¨ Ubung

Boyer-Moore-Algorithmus

Aufgabe 1 (5 Punkte): Berechnen Sie f¨ur die Strings abcabcabc, aabababab und abbabab jeweils die Werte L(i), L0(i) und l0(i).

Aufgabe 2 (5 Punkte): Wenden Sie den Boyer-Moore-Algorithmus auf den Text

acababacabababa und das Pattern abacaba an und geben Sie f¨ur jeden Schritt an, wie groß die Verschiebung des Patterns jeweils nach der Good-Suffix-Regel und nach der Bad- Character-Regel w¨are.

Aufgabe 3 (5 Punkte): Beweisen Sie:l0(i) ist der gr¨oßte Indexj ≤m−i+1, sodassNj(P) =j. Anmerkung: Nj(P) ist die L¨ange des l¨angsten Suffixes vonP[1. . . j], der gleichzeitig Suffix von P ist.

Aufgabe 4 (5 Punkte): Konstruieren Sie ein Beispiel (Text und Pattern), f¨ur das der Boyer- Moore-Algorithmus weniger Vergleiche ben¨otigt, wenn nur die Bad-Character-Regel ange- wendet wird, als wenn diese mit der Good-Suffix-Regel kombiniert wird.

1

Referenzen

ÄHNLICHE DOKUMENTE

Achtung: Für die Lösung verwenden Sie bitte das beiliegende Einzelblatt, auf dem Sie auch Ihre Matrikelnummer vermerken!.. Aufgabe 7: 18 Punkte. Mit der Herstellung eines

Betrachten wir die Ereignisse im Bezugssystem S: Damit das Paket die Camelot erreicht, das in einem x-Abstand δx = d entlangfliegt, muss es ebenso wie die Camelot eine Geschwindig-

[r]

(auf Vorrat) Sei ABC ein Dreieck und φ eine affine Abbildung

Was erh¨alt man als Hintereinanderausf¨uhrung zweier Spiegelungen in der

[r]

Nicht jeder reell abgeschlossene K¨ orper ist aber isomorph zu R , denn sonst w¨ urde (b) offensichtlich f¨ ur jeden reell abgeschlossenen K¨ orper R gelten, was nicht der Fall ist,

Wie im Beweis des Isolationssatzes 2.1.8 sei K ein Kegel im Vektorraum V mit Einheit u, der maximal ist bez¨ uglich der Eigenschaft −u nicht